Output 9b20733059030e5df87e237b64cf717ec675df253930a5cc897ee73c0d6207f0: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f51d5849a914f600917e67dc496b91ecebd5de3 OP_EQUAL
address
361DiVMCYqb8d8C8YHSpWyg5gbBqXL6dLd
transaction
9b20733059030e5df87e237b64cf717ec675df253930a5cc897ee73c0d6207f0
spent
true